Overview
A welding liquid level gauge is a critical instrument used in industrial settings to monitor liquid levels in tanks, boilers, and pressure vessels. It is commonly employed in industries such as petrochemical, power generation, and food processing. The gauge ensures operational safety by preventing overfilling or dry running, which can lead to equipment damage or hazardous situations. These gauges are designed to withstand high pressures and corrosive environments, making them suitable for demanding applications. They are available in various configurations, including magnetic, transparent, and reflex types, each tailored to specific industrial needs. Their robust construction and reliability make them indispensable in liquid level management.
Structure and Working Principle
A typical welding liquid level gauge consists of a body made from stainless steel or reinforced plastic, a viewing window (often tempered glass), and sealing components. The gauge is installed directly onto the tank or vessel, allowing the liquid level to be observed through the transparent section. The working principle depends on the type of gauge. For example, reflex gauges use light refraction to indicate the liquid level, while magnetic gauges employ a float with a magnet that moves with the liquid level, activating indicators on the exterior. These mechanisms ensure accurate and real-time level monitoring without direct contact with the liquid.
Key Features
Welding liquid level gauges are known for their durability and resistance to harsh industrial environments. They are constructed from materials like stainless steel or reinforced plastic to withstand corrosion and high pressures. The viewing windows are typically made from tempered glass or polycarbonate for clear visibility and impact resistance. Another key feature is their ease of installation and maintenance. Many models are designed for quick mounting and disassembly, facilitating routine inspections and cleaning. Additionally, some advanced gauges come with integrated alarms or remote monitoring capabilities, enhancing their functionality in automated systems.
Application Areas
Welding liquid level gauges are widely used in industries where precise liquid level monitoring is crucial. In the petrochemical industry, they help manage fuel and chemical storage tanks. Power plants use them to monitor water levels in boilers and condensate tanks. They are also essential in the food and beverage industry, where hygiene and accuracy are paramount. Other applications include pharmaceutical manufacturing, wastewater treatment, and HVAC systems. Their versatility and reliability make them a staple in various industrial processes.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of welding liquid level gauges. Inspect the gauge for signs of wear, corrosion, or leaks periodically. Clean the viewing window to maintain clear visibility, and replace any damaged components promptly. Precautions include avoiding mechanical impacts that could crack the glass or distort the gauge body. Ensure the gauge is compatible with the measured liquid to prevent chemical reactions or material degradation. Calibration checks should be performed regularly to maintain measurement accuracy, especially in critical applications.
B2B Procurement Guide
When procuring welding liquid level gauges, consider factors such as material compatibility, pressure rating, and environmental conditions. Stainless steel gauges are ideal for corrosive environments, while plastic models may suffice for less demanding applications. Evaluate the gauge's specifications, including temperature range and connection type, to ensure it meets your operational requirements. Supplier reliability and after-sales support are also critical. Request samples or certifications to verify quality standards. Bulk purchases may offer cost savings, but always prioritize quality and suitability for your specific needs.
